The Leidos National Security Sector, Navy & Air Force Sustainment Division is seeking a Quality Engineer at our San Diego CA. office to join our team in the Quality Assurance Department Program which provides quality assurance, control, inspection and technical installation support for PEO IWS5 NAVSEA SONAR SQQ-89 A(V)15 and NIWC (Naval Information Warfare Center) C4ISR installation programs. Responsibilities – Work you’ll do:

  • Perform QA oversight and inspections on electrical, electronic, and mechanical system installation projects for DDG and CG class ships.

  • Assist team lead and project manager with the installation quality assurance and quality control and prevention efforts. Conduct and support necessary test and inspections for installation projects.

  • Monitor and assure the installation items identified in the contract, SOW, task orders, and installation drawings are in accordance with the applicable military, commercial, OSHA, local standards for a quality product.

  • Be a quality liaison between ship force, shipyard, and NAVSEA customer personnel to prevent, resolve and correct installation quality & safety issues and discrepancies.

  • Develop, prepare and review quality plans of action for each ship or shore installation projects from start to finish IAW with the NAVESA, SOW, contract requirements.

  • Develop, prepare, and review Test and Inspection QA workbooks and documentation for each ship or shore installation projects from start to finish IAW with the NAVESA 009-04 and 9090-310 requirements.

  • Prepare Quality Control Reports for each project site from start to finish. Input and maintain the report data in the applicable inspection system data base or documented information reporting format including gathering trend data

  • Knowledge of Method A, B, C, D corrective actions, determine and write effective corrective and preventive actions, and root cause analysis.

  • Perform and support the installation, fabrication and wiring of shipboard system Multi-pin Connectors, Fiber Optics, CAT5, Electrical Cable & Cableways, Multi- Cable Penetrations, Electrical Equipment Power Panels, Transformers and Load Centers/Switch Boards and Bonding/Grounding.

  • Perform I, V and G test and inspections on Multi-pin Connectors, Fiber Optics, CAT5, Electrical Cable & Cableways, Multi- Cable Penetrations, Electrical Equipment Power Panels, Transformers and Load Centers/Switch Boards, Bonding/Grounding, Electrical Safety and Surface Preservation

Required Experience, Skills, and Education:

  • Bachelor’s Degree from an accredited college in the related Quality Engineering/ Assurance discipline or the equivalent (additional experience, education and training may be considered in lieu of degree).

  • Requires 2+ years of Quality Engineering/Assurance experience.

  • Minimum 4+ years of combined Shipboard Electrical/Electronic Systems Installations and Quality Control/Inspector experience.

  • OSHA 10-hour 7615 Maritime Shipyard Employment Qualified (certification required)

  • Active DoD Secret Clearance required to start.

  • Must have or be able to possess a valid US Passport

  • Proficient with MS Office and strong oral and written communication.

  • Ability to lift 50 pounds and climb up and go down ladders.

Preferred Experience, Skills, and Education – Favorable if you have:

  • Shipboard/Submarine Electrical/Electronic Cable and Cableway Inspector Qualified.

  • Shipboard/Submarine Electrical/Electronic Connector Fabricator or Inspector Qualified.  

  • Shipboard/ Submarine Fiber optic Cable Handler, Installer, Fabricator, or Inspector Qualified.

  • Experience in Shipboard/Submarine basic wiring and inspections of electrical/electronic equipment and connection boxes.

  • Experience with reading and understanding shipboard or submarine system drawings (i.e. electrical, structural, mechanical).

  • Visual TEMPEST Inspector.

  • Level II NDT visual VT and PT Inspector of structural welds, piping to meet NAVSEA requirements. 

  • Understand and familiar with the welding requirements for Level II visual VT and PT observations or inspections of structural welds, piping to meet NAVSEA requirements.

  • SCP Shipyard Competent Person.

  • NAVSEA PAINT Inspector.

  • Experience in interfacing with the government and navy representative and personnel.

What you need to know about the Los Angeles Tech Scene

Los Angeles is a global leader in entertainment, so it’s no surprise that many of the biggest players in streaming, digital media and game development call the city home. But the city boasts plenty of non-entertainment innovation as well, with tech companies spanning verticals like AI, fintech, e-commerce and biotech. With major universities like Caltech, UCLA, USC and the nearby UC Irvine, the city has a steady supply of top-flight tech and engineering talent — not counting the graduates flocking to Los Angeles from across the world to enjoy its beaches, culture and year-round temperate climate.

Key Facts About Los Angeles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 375,800; 5.5%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Snap, Netflix, SpaceX, Disney, Google
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, adtech, media, software, game development
  • Funding Landscape: $11.6 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Strong Ventures, Fifth Wall, Upfront Ventures, Mucker Capital, Kittyhawk Ventures
  • Research Centers and Universities: California Institute of Technology, UCLA, University of Southern California, UC Irvine, Pepperdine, California Institute for Immunology and Immunotherapy, Center for Quantum Science and Engineering
